打印

请教一个关于AD测量不稳定的问题!

[复制链接]
3054|16
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
stealth|  楼主 | 2009-12-14 10:32 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我试了几款内置12位A/D的单片机,想要测量陀螺仪的输出值。但测量的结果不稳定,上小跳动有7,8个位。AD的参考电平和陀螺仪的电源已经都接在一个比较好的LDO上。我怀疑是AD输入阻抗过小,而陀螺仪输出阻抗又过大的问题。因为如果是测量电阻分出来的电压,跳动只有上下2位。而且我用独立的AD芯片(MAX147)来接陀螺仪,效果就很好,基本稳定在上下1位而已,MAX147没有标输入阻抗,我想应该是很大。不知道我想的对不对,到底是不是阻抗的问题呢?
请教各位DX,如果是阻抗的问题,该怎么解决呢?有没有什么无源的电路能解决这个问题呢?考虑到温漂和我要求的高精度,我试过用运放做跟随是不行的,所以只要考虑无源的了。

相关帖子

沙发
韩秋婷| | 2009-12-14 10:36 | 只看该作者
用过采样算法可以勉强达到标称的分辨率
另外 你的基准用ldo?

使用特权

评论回复
板凳
stealth|  楼主 | 2009-12-14 10:46 | 只看该作者
基准和陀螺仪的电源都用同一个LDO。我是想达到原始的采集数据就有上下2位的精度。

使用特权

评论回复
地板
宇容创行| | 2009-12-14 10:48 | 只看该作者
跳动这么厉害,可以多次采样,取平均,也就是所谓的过采样,噪声也不用引入了

使用特权

评论回复
5
stealth|  楼主 | 2009-12-14 10:57 | 只看该作者
问题是如果用MAX147,很精确啊!不是噪音的问题。

使用特权

评论回复
6
xwj| | 2009-12-14 12:14 | 只看该作者
加个运放缓冲肯定是可以的,陀螺仪不需要多高的精度。

使用特权

评论回复
7
xwj| | 2009-12-14 12:15 | 只看该作者
而且,我很怀疑是你的单片机的AD的问题。

使用特权

评论回复
8
stealth|  楼主 | 2009-12-14 12:23 | 只看该作者
加过运放,效果很差。我是需要很高精度的,一般1.4V左右的输出,只要有>0.75mv的波动,就不可以忽略了。

使用特权

评论回复
9
hab2000| | 2009-12-14 12:33 | 只看该作者
既然要求较高,为什么用基准?LDO稳定度多高?

使用特权

评论回复
10
stealth|  楼主 | 2009-12-14 13:04 | 只看该作者
LDO有温漂啊,如果不用基准,基准稳定,LDO漂了,那更不行。基本这点我研究过,用LDO是可以的。现在没有LDO的问题。

使用特权

评论回复
11
zjp8683463| | 2009-12-14 13:10 | 只看该作者
按你所说,接外挂ADC没有问题,那么就是你片内ADC的问题。
ADC大部分是有缓冲器的,即输入阻抗很大。你可以查看下ADC的资料,看看有没有buffer

使用特权

评论回复
12
stealth|  楼主 | 2009-12-14 13:55 | 只看该作者
查了,片内ADC的输入阻抗最大才350K.

使用特权

评论回复
13
oldcat8999| | 2009-12-14 16:16 | 只看该作者
1、AD转换的结果可以进行滤波,均值滤波或SISO的卡尔曼滤波。
2、AD的电压参考接在LDO上? 楼主自觉面壁去。
3、如果陀螺仪输出阻抗大,那可以加上运放做跟随,不要随便说运放不好、不能用,运放的使用需要注意一些问题,把问题研究明白再来说运放好不好用。
话说俺以前做过高精密称重和温度检测,都用的运放/仪放,温度稳定/称重物不变时,用万用表测量输出能稳定再1uV上,16位AD能有效用到13-14位的,楼主要在电路设计上下功夫。

使用特权

评论回复
14
stealth|  楼主 | 2009-12-14 17:02 | 只看该作者
AD的参考电平如果不和陀螺仪为一个电源,那陀螺仪的输出受其电源的温漂的影响,输出也会跟着漂。
楼上的能不能给个接运放的电路?成本接受不了贵的运防,只能是普通的。

使用特权

评论回复
15
一从陶令| | 2009-12-14 21:48 | 只看该作者
现在12位AD做出的东西都可以叫高精度啦?那24位的呢?

温漂是个长期的变化,你这个测出来变化7/8个位跟温漂有什么关系?难道你的工作场所温度忽冷忽热?

加运放肯定是可以的,你大概没仔细研究过运放电路。

你的现象我怀疑和采样瞬间AD电流流动、LDO负载调整率不太好、陀螺仪和AD参考输入之间距离又不是特别近有关,造成两者之间的电源起伏形成的。你检查一下电路,应保证陀螺仪和AD之间采用单点接电源和地,并有足够去耦电容。

使用特权

评论回复
16
magic1983| | 2009-12-15 14:13 | 只看该作者
陀螺仪不懂,给你个建议
找个同类厂家的拆开看看,分析分析,
该会找到点什么

使用特权

评论回复
17
oldcat8999| | 2009-12-22 17:36 | 只看该作者
回14楼的问题:
我在北航读本科时也搞过一阵陀螺仪,所以对这玩艺还有些了解。
关于电源温漂、噪声的问题,你需要明确你的电路要求精度后才能确定,而且这也和你选择的电源有关,一句话说不明白。
关于运放电路问题,有很多廉价的选择,比如OP27,只要7毛,这个够便宜了吧,精度还不错的,只要你原理图和PCB设计上没有问题。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

16

主题

87

帖子

1

粉丝